Phase I Clinical Study of Chimeric Antigen Receptor T Cells (C-13-60) in the Treatment of Carcinoembryonic Antigen (CEA) Positive Advanced Malignant Solid Tumors
Chongqing Precision Biotech Co., Ltd is advancing its C-13-60 CAR-T cell therapy targeting CEA-positive advanced malignant solid tumors through a Phase I clinical trial. The trial aims to establish safety, tolerability, and pharmacokinetics while preliminarily assessing efficacy. The targeted patient population includes those with advanced colorectal, esophageal, gastric, pancreatic, non-small cell lung, breast, and cholangiocarcinoma who have exhausted standard treatment options.
